The*_*heo 4 subscription in-app-purchase ios app-store-connect
我的 iOS 应用程序当前提供自动续订订阅A。我想以折扣价添加第二个订阅选项B。选项B仅适用于过去通过应用内购买购买了某个升级X的用户(该应用内购买不再提供销售)。
如何防止用户在系统设置中订阅A然后切换到B ?没有购买X的用户甚至不应该知道B的存在。
据我了解Apple的文档和App Store Connect Help,用户可以在同一订阅组中的订阅之间升级/降级/交叉升级。我认为通过将订阅添加到两个不同的订阅组,不可能在A和B之间切换,但我找不到对此的明确答案。
如果用户开始任何订阅,他们会自动在系统设置中看到所有订阅组,还是仅看到具有有效订阅的组?
如果用户开始任何订阅,他们会自动在系统设置中看到所有订阅组,还是仅看到具有有效订阅的组?
用户永远无法看到其他订阅组的产品。仅当A和B位于同一订阅组中时,用户才能够使用系统设置更改计划。
要确定用户是否有资格购买B,您可以检查收据的latest_receipt_info属性。如果存在X的购买记录,则提供用户订阅B,否则提供A。
| 归档时间: |
|
| 查看次数: |
849 次 |
| 最近记录: |